Query leads to endless loop (because of Optimizer?) #1275

Open tcm-marcel opened 6 years ago

tcm-marcel commented 6 years ago

Running TPC-H Q13 leads to an endless loop in peloton. I tried to follow the execution path and it seems to me that the optimizer runs in infinitely many tasks and the actual execution never starts. However, I am not familiar with this part of peloton.

TPC-H Q13 (includes creating schema) ```sql CREATE TABLE nation ( n_nationkey INTEGER NOT NULL, n_name CHAR(25) NOT NULL, n_regionkey INTEGER NOT NULL, n_comment VARCHAR(152)); CREATE TABLE region ( r_regionkey INTEGER NOT NULL, r_name CHAR(25) NOT NULL, r_comment VARCHAR(152)); CREATE TABLE part ( p_partkey INTEGER NOT NULL, p_name VARCHAR(55) NOT NULL, p_mfgr CHAR(25) NOT NULL, p_brand CHAR(10) NOT NULL, p_type VARCHAR(25) NOT NULL, p_size INTEGER NOT NULL, p_container CHAR(10) NOT NULL, p_retailprice DECIMAL(15,2) NOT NULL, p_comment VARCHAR(23) NOT NULL ); CREATE TABLE supplier ( s_suppkey INTEGER NOT NULL, s_name CHAR(25) NOT NULL, s_address VARCHAR(40) NOT NULL, s_nationkey INTEGER NOT NULL, s_phone CHAR(15) NOT NULL, s_acctbal DECIMAL(15,2) NOT NULL, s_comment VARCHAR(101) NOT NULL); CREATE TABLE partsupp ( ps_partkey INTEGER NOT NULL, ps_suppkey INTEGER NOT NULL, ps_availqty INTEGER NOT NULL, ps_supplycost DECIMAL(15,2) NOT NULL, ps_comment VARCHAR(199) NOT NULL ); CREATE TABLE customer ( c_custkey INTEGER NOT NULL, c_name VARCHAR(25) NOT NULL, c_address VARCHAR(40) NOT NULL, c_nationkey INTEGER NOT NULL, c_phone CHAR(15) NOT NULL, c_acctbal DECIMAL(15,2) NOT NULL, c_mktsegment CHAR(10) NOT NULL, c_comment VARCHAR(117) NOT NULL); CREATE TABLE orders ( o_orderkey INTEGER NOT NULL, o_custkey INTEGER NOT NULL, o_orderstatus CHAR(1) NOT NULL, o_totalprice DECIMAL(15,2) NOT NULL, o_orderdate DATE NOT NULL, o_orderpriority CHAR(15) NOT NULL, o_clerk CHAR(15) NOT NULL, o_shippriority INTEGER NOT NULL, o_comment VARCHAR(79) NOT NULL); CREATE TABLE lineitem ( l_orderkey INTEGER NOT NULL, l_partkey INTEGER NOT NULL, l_suppkey INTEGER NOT NULL, l_linenumber INTEGER NOT NULL, l_quantity DECIMAL(15,2) NOT NULL, l_extendedprice DECIMAL(15,2) NOT NULL, l_discount DECIMAL(15,2) NOT NULL, l_tax DECIMAL(15,2) NOT NULL, l_returnflag CHAR(1) NOT NULL, l_linestatus CHAR(1) NOT NULL, l_shipdate DATE NOT NULL, l_commitdate DATE NOT NULL, l_receiptdate DATE NOT NULL, l_shipinstruct CHAR(25) NOT NULL, l_shipmode CHAR(10) NOT NULL, l_comment VARCHAR(44) NOT NULL); select c_count, count(*) as custdist from ( select c_custkey, count(o_orderkey) as c_count from customer left outer join orders on c_custkey = o_custkey and o_comment not like '%special%deposits%' group by c_custkey ) as c_orders group by c_count order by count(*) desc, c_count desc; ```

GustavoAngulo commented 6 years ago

@tcm-marcel The loop is caused because this query contains a Left Outer Join. A group in 15721 is working on implementing outer joins in the optimizer (#1280) so it should hopefully be fixed soon. I'll keep the issue open for now.

For the future though we should probably throw an exception for unimplemented SQL functions in the optimizer instead of looping.
